Ideally located, the newly restored lavender barn offers privacy and convenience, just step outside and you are a one-minute walk from the village center and it’s local wine bar & restaurant, also a 4 minute walk from the ancient Chateau.

The village of Lardiers is close to Banon where there is an excellent bookshop, small supermarket, restaurants, a wine bar, cafés, bakery, butchers and weekly market. It is the perfect place to unwind and experience French cafe culture.

This central area of Provence is the perfect location for explorers of medieval hill top villages, for walkers and cyclists who enjoy the beauty of the vast area of the Montagne de Lur. This hidden area in the Alpes de haute Provence is extraordinarily beautiful with many opportunities for day trips. You can sample world-class wines, wander through fields of lavender and sunflowers, shop in open-air markets, and enjoy outdoor activities.

Close by are the towns of Forcalquier, Manosque, Apt and Sisteron with their museums and medieval architecture. From this central Provence location day trips to Avignon, Aix en Provence, Marseille and many other internationally renowned places are within easy reach.

Mike & Rosi purchased the old lavender barn in 2009, which had change very little during it's very long history. Formally owned by the Chateau of Lardiers, where the owners would have brought the lavender from the fields to distil into essence of lavender at the ancient barn, before transporting the oil's to Marseille. Mike & Rosi were able to draw on their years of experience restoring old properties and their former business activities to convert the barn into a domestic accomodation.

About the neighborhood

Lardiers

Located in Lardiers, this vacation home is in the mountains. Prieuré Notre-Dame de Salagon and Musée Terre et Temps are local landmarks, and some of the area's activities can be experienced at Domaine de Mourchon and Valvital - Montbrun-les-Bains Thermal Baths. Haute-Provence Observatory and La Germanette are also worth visiting. Be sure to check out the area's animals with activities such as game walks and birdwatching.
